Moving Perspectives Symposium in Copenhagen
Join us in Copenhagen for two days of expanding our views on inclusion, representation & institutional responsibility in the performing arts sectors across Europe.
The symposium Moving Perspectives celebrates the conclusion of three years of Europe wide collaboration of performing arts residencies in the project Moving Identities.
Around 100 artists, curators, project managers, and decision-makers will gather in Copenhagen to share knowledge and engage networks in moving perspectives and develop new insights into how the European performing arts can become more inclusive, representative, and socially and environmentally responsible.
The symposium is a professional forum for reflection, exchange, and inspiration, where performing arts professionals come together to discuss concrete challenges and approaches.
The two-day program consists of panel talks with artists and institutions, discussion groups and workshops, performances, and informal celebratory activities.
